Erler Zimmer Bladder Catheterisation Simulator in detail

This set of training models for the education and training of transurethral bladder catheterisation in humans was named after Henri Dunant and Florence Nightingale to express our respect and appreciation for these historical figures in the nursing field. The naming also reflects the claim of these models to be a milestone in nursing training and to set new standards.

Both models are ideally suited for training in education and are characterised by the use of high-quality materials that are very close to the feel and look of a real person and yet are robust and hard-wearing. The lower body allows the insertion of both male and female genitals, whereby the anatomical position of the genitals and urethra has been strictly observed. The novel bladder can be placed flexibly in the body to create a perfect connection with both the female and male genitalia.

Due to the appropriate design of the shape of the bladder and the use of a novel valve in the bladder, no resistance is felt when inserting the catheter into the bladder, so that students cannot "feel" the correct insertion depth. This special feature clearly sets the model apart from other trainers with a conventional valve. The transparent bladder allows the position of the catheter and the blockage to be seen. In addition, the bladder is connected to a fluid supply bag so that fluid escapes if catheterisation is successful.

The male genitalia has a replaceable foreskin that can be moved just like in humans. This means that handling and hygiene can be practised. The model has the most realistic urethra of all catheterisation trainers currently available on the market. All four sections of the urethra are represented with the corresponding anatomical shape and realistic resistance during catheterisation. By attaching a strap, the narrowing of the prostate due to BPH or prostate cancer can be simulated and the resulting use of a larger or firmer catheter practised.

The female genitalia is designed in such a way that the flexible labia must be spread to find the urethral opening. The design of the urethral opening requires careful attention, as it is not immediately obvious, but requires appropriate care, just like with a real patient. The urethra offers realistic resistance when inserting the catheter.

The bladder catheterisation simulator Henri, male, is supplied with a transport bag.

The bladder catheterisation simulator Florence, female, is also supplied with a transport bag.
